PASSIVE DUST FILTER FOR AN INSPECTION HATCH
The invention is directed to a passive dust filtering system for an inspection hatch of steel bulk storage vessel. The system includes a filter containment unit and an adaptor section for securing the unit to the storage vessel. The adaptor section includes a mounting flange having one or more magnetic switches to engage the storage vessel. A purge control system is used to periodically pulse air into filter elements in the filter containment unit to blow dust from the outside of the filter elements back into the vessel.
DUST FILTER FOR INTEGRATION WITH A CONVEYOR SKIRTING SYSTEM
The invention is directed to a dust filter system for integration with a conveyor skirting system. The systems are configured for handing dust from dry bulk materials being transported on a conveyor. The skirting system includes a top, a first side wall and a second side wall and is mounted above a portion of the conveyor. The dust filtering system is mounted on the top of the skirting system and includes an opening connected to a discharge plenum having a blower fan. A dust suppression manifold for spraying a chemical solution is connected to the top of the conveyor skirt downstream the dust filtering system.

Self-Locking Manifold and Filter
A filter that is self-locking to a filter manifold includes a flange having a major axis and a minor axis in plan view, and that is longer along the major axis than the minor axis. The filter further includes a stopper on the major axis, that can contact a filter manifold when the filter is inserted into the manifold and rotated. The filter can be used with a filter manifold having a slot with an opening having a width greater than the length of the minor axis and smaller than the length along the major axis of the flange, and past the opening, has sufficient width to accommodate the length of the major axis. This arrangement allows the flange to be inserted into the slot in an insertion orientation, but does not permit the flange to pass through the opening of the slot when it is in a locking position.

Flexible filter cage for a make-up air module
A flexible filter cage for receiving an air filter in an air conditioner unit includes a first frame portion and a second frame portion spaced apart from the first frame portion to define a frame cavity therebetween. A flexible bridge extends between and flexibly connects the first frame portion and the second frame portion to permit flexing of the filter cage up to a predetermined angle which facilitates easy mounting into a filter slot defined by the air conditioner unit.

Ceramic honeycomb bodies, honeycomb extrusion dies, and methods of making ceramic honeycomb bodies
A method to form a laminar integral skin of a honeycomb structure is provided. The method includes extruding a ceramic precursor batch through a die with feedholes in entry side and slots in exit face of the die to form the honeycomb structure. In a region on the periphery of the die configured to form the cell matrix, a series of concentric slots around the matrix in the exit face of the die are configured to feed skin onto the matrix. Ring sections between concentric slots are angled away from the center and a mask is disposed on top of the periphery producing a channel for extruded skin to meet and bond to extruded matrix. Optionally, slots in the skin-forming ring sections enhance knitting between laminar skin layers. The die and honeycomb body having uniform integral skin are also provided.
